Full Description

Four post medieval or early modern trackways are visible as earthworks on lidar imagery within Moreton Plantation, Affpuddle. The trackways are formed of narrow linear ditches, aligned north west-south east and south west-north east. They are visible over an area measuring aproximately 225 m by 125 m. (1) These features were digitally plotted during the Wild Purbeck Mapping Project.
